What Saily actually is
Saily is the travel eSIM brand from Nord Security, the company behind NordVPN. Its app bundles ad blocking and a virtual-location feature alongside the data plan. The catalogue is narrower than Airalo's and the pricing is mid-market rather than budget — you are partly paying for the software layer.
Who it suits
- ✓Travellers already invested in the Nord ecosystem
- ✓Anyone who values the bundled ad blocking and web protection
- ✓People who want a polished app from an established security vendor
When to look elsewhere
- →Pure cost-per-gigabyte shopping, where budget providers win
- →Destinations outside Saily's narrower catalogue
- →Travellers who already run a VPN, making the bundled extras redundant
Verdict
Saily is a reasonable product with a specific pitch. If the security bundle appeals, the premium is modest. If it does not — and if you already run a VPN, it probably does not — the comparison below shows what the same money buys from providers competing purely on data.
Where Saily sits against every alternative
Median cost per gigabyte across the same eight benchmark destinations, so no provider is measured on markets that happen to suit it. Saily currently ranks 6 of 6 at $1.92 per GB.
| Provider | Median $/GB | Entry | Basket coverage |
|---|---|---|---|
| Airalo | $0.77 | $4.00 | 8 of 8 |
| BreezeSIM | $0.77 | $1.17 | 8 of 8 |
| Roamix | $0.78 | $0.85 | 8 of 8 |
| eSIMPal | $1.27 | $2.90 | 8 of 8 |
| Nomad | $1.53 | $4.00 | 8 of 8 |
| SailyThis page | $1.92 | $2.99 | 8 of 8 |
